Klimchak will discuss his musical compositional methods which involve the intersection of home-built instruments, low and high tech sound manipulation, and live performance. He will perform 2 pieces, WaterWorks (2004) for a large bowl of amplified water, and Sticks and Tones (2016) for frame drum, melodica and laptop. His performance will be in the room 115 of the Couch Building on Georgia Tech’s campus and is open to the public.
